Image.Load

Load(string, LoadOptions)

يقوم بتحميل صورة جديدة من مسار الملف أو عنوان URL المحدد. إذا كان filePath مسار ملف، فإن الطريقة تفتح الملف فقط. إذا كان filePath عنوان URL، فإن الطريقة تقوم بتنزيل الملف، وتخزينه مؤقتًا، ثم فتحه.

public static Image Load(string filePath, LoadOptions loadOptions)
معاملنوعالوصف
filePathStringمسار الملف أو عنوان URL لتحميل الصورة منه.
loadOptionsLoadOptionsخيارات التحميل.

قيمة الإرجاع

الصورة المحملة.

انظر أيضًا


Load(string)

يقوم بتحميل صورة جديدة من مسار الملف أو عنوان URL المحدد. إذا كان filePath مسار ملف، فإن الطريقة تفتح الملف فقط. إذا كان filePath عنوان URL، فإن الطريقة تقوم بتنزيل الملف، وتخزينه مؤقتًا، ثم فتحه.

public static Image Load(string filePath)
معاملنوعالوصف
filePathStringمسار الملف أو عنوان URL لتحميل الصورة منه.

قيمة الإرجاع

الصورة المحملة.

أمثلة

هذا المثال يوضح تحميل ملف Image موجود إلى كائن من Aspose.Imaging.Image باستخدام مسار الملف المحدد

[C#]

//إنشاء كائن Image وتهيئته بملف صورة موجود من موقع القرص
using (Aspose.Imaging.Image image = Aspose.Imaging.Image.Load(@"C:\temp\sample.bmp"))
{
    //قم ببعض معالجة الصورة.
}

انظر أيضًا


Load(Stream, LoadOptions)

يقوم بتحميل صورة جديدة من الدفق المحدد.

public static Image Load(Stream stream, LoadOptions loadOptions)
معاملنوعالوصف
streamStreamدفق البيانات لتحميل الصورة منه.
loadOptionsLoadOptionsخيارات التحميل.

قيمة الإرجاع

الصورة المحملة.

انظر أيضًا


Load(Stream)

يقوم بتحميل صورة جديدة من الدفق المحدد.

public static Image Load(Stream stream)
معاملنوعالوصف
streamStreamدفق البيانات لتحميل الصورة منه.

قيمة الإرجاع

الصورة المحملة.

أمثلة

هذا المثال يوضح استخدام كائنات System.IO.Stream لتحميل ملف Image موجود

[C#]

//إنشاء مثيل من FileStream
using (System.IO.FileStream stream = new System.IO.FileStream(@"C:\temp\sample.bmp", System.IO.FileMode.Open))
{
    //إنشاء مثال من فئة Image وتحميل ملف موجود عبر كائن FileStream عن طريق استدعاء طريقة Load
    using (Aspose.Imaging.Image image = Aspose.Imaging.Image.Load(stream))
    {
        //إجراء بعض معالجة الصور.
    }
}

انظر أيضًا